Electrical question about no neutral

When we visit some musical friends, we park next to their drive-in shed. There's a Lincoln arc welder that connects to an old-fashioned 3-prong 50A connector. To get air conditioning in the summer, I want to make an adapter form the 3-pin to the 4-pin connector for the Monty. I have found and bought the connectors. I'm thinking that bonding the neutral and ground together will work fine to get two hots and a return path and won't cause issues with the trailer wiring. Any thoughts from the electricians in the group? Of course, anything I do is my own responsibility.

I do sort of the same thing, ran a line that plugs into a Welder outlet with the neutral and ground bonded together at the outlet. Problem I had, my EMS wouldn't let power through until I added a ground rod right next to the RV outlet post. Now works like a champ.
